Aquatic plants are plants adapted to living in water. they thrive in freshwater, saltwater, and brackish environments. these plants have specialized adaptations for surviving and growing submerged or floating in water bodies, serving important ecological roles in aquatic ecosystems. aquatic plants name aquatic plants are also called water plants. read: all plants names water plants names list.

10 Aquatic Plants Name Water Plants Names List With 8. yellow pond lily ( nuphar lutea ) this water lily is known for its large yellow star shaped flowers that bloom throughout warmer months. it also has large floating green leaves that can carpet the water’s surface. the plant is native to areas in europe, asia, africa, and north america, where it grows in freshwater. The plant’s foliage mainly grows above the water level. submerged aquatic plants. these types of water plants are also called oxygenating pond plants. the stems and leaves of these freshwater and saltwater aquatic plants grow entirely underwater. free floating pond plants. some flowering aquatic plants float freely in the water.
